Boston (Castillo) @ Seattle (Pineiro)

Well the musical pitchers game the Rangers played yesterday caused a no play.

Your not going to get the Mariners at this low a price at home very often and I am going to get on it! The Red Sox are kicking butt since they got rid of that bum Jimmy Williams (who is now in Houston ruining them) but are coming off of a sweep of the A's and I see a little let down against a Mariners team that loves right handed pitchers especially this one.

Boston sends Frank Castillo to the hill who is 2-2 on the year with an ERA of 3.25 and a WHIP of 0.861 in 6 starts. He has faced the Mariners 5 times with his teams losing all of them and he has an ERA of 11.14 and a WHIP of 2.190 in those starts.

The Mariners counter with Joel Pineiro who got roughed up a bit in his last start he is 1-0 in 2 starts for the year with an ERA of 5.62 and a WHIP of 1.875 both starts coming on the road. I look for that to change here in the friendly confines of Safeco.

The Boston offense has been very solid especially on the road where they are averaging 6.3 runs a game batting .308 as a team against right handed starters with an on base percentage of .408.

The Mariners have not been shy about scoring runs either especially against right handed starters averaging 6 runs a game batting .281 as a team against them with an on base percentage of .400.

The Red Sox bullpen has been a little shaky in their last 3 games with an ERA of 5.59, defensively they are playing well allowing the opposition to bat .206 with an on base percentage of .268 while giving up just 3.1 runs a game but have been error prone with 23 on the road.

The Seattle bullpen has been solid at home with an ERA of 2.89 and a WHIP of 1.214 while the defense has been allowing the other team to bat .262 with an on base percentage of .345 while scoring 4.6 runs a game on average.

I like our chances here with the Mariners against a pitcher they have had no trouble hitting and scoring against, while I look for Pineiro to pitch a little better at home where he did well last year. I would bet the over but I never bet totals without knowing the home plate umpire! So I will take my chances with the Mariners at home against a Boston team fresh off sweep!

Playing Seattle -138
